  • 3. 

    Which association regulates the CEN? 

    • A.

      BCEN

    • B.

      THEN

    • C.

      PREN

    • D.

      BCIN

    Correct Answer
    A. BCEN
    Explanation
    The correct answer is BCEN. BCEN stands for the Board of Certification for Emergency Nursing. It is an association that regulates the CEN, which stands for Certified Emergency Nurse. The BCEN is responsible for setting the standards and requirements for emergency nursing certification and ensuring that nurses meet these standards through rigorous testing and ongoing education.
